After Neik and Kyanna's conversation was interrupted by a terrible joke, the group had set off. Not even a few minutes after they had left the small village the inn belonged to, and they were already being attacked by a pack of wild wolves. These wolves were often considered Wolf Gods, which were borderline monsters, rather than regular animals. It wasn't something unfamiliar to Neik in the slightest. He'd slain many of these giant beasts before he was even 15. However, that didn't mean they weren't a force to be reckoned with...

Hearing them before they could be seen, Neik immediately jumped back and took a defensive pose as a blue aura suddenly surrounded him. The next moment, he'd pulled an intricately woven sword from thin air, which materialized in the form of appeared to be thousands of shattered crystals, until its form was vividly complete. Once this strange from of magic, the likes of which none there aside from the user itself had seen before now, was finished illuminating Neik's body, he stood at the ready.

"Wolves!" he shouted just as the pack emerged from the cover of trees beside the group's path. Clementine responded to their sudden appearance with a very clumsy attempt at fending one of them off, which resulted in her rapier being stolen from her by the wolf whose hide she thrust into. The hilt of the weapon was seen for a flash before it disappeared within the pack of wolves as they stood their ground, snarling at their prey whilst pacing back and forth, searching for some kind of opening. There was a total of 5 wolves in all; one for each member of the group fending them off. Whether that number was meant to evenly fill these wolves' bellies or for each hero to have a chance at slaying such a monstrous beast was still up for debate. That being said, Neik wasn't about to die here to a bunch of mangy mutts, even if that meant he had to slay them all himself.

Scowling at Clementine's poor performance, Neik charged in ahead of the group, as was his style; quick, preemptive, and powerful. Pulling out a couple of small blades from his blue aura, he flung each one at the wolves flanking his left and right; the speed and aim of the blades were unprecedented, far faster than what Kyanna had thrown in a fit of anger towards Neik moments previously. The blades jammed into the eye of either wolf, stunning them for as long as required to allow Neik the chance he needed to go after his personal target; the wolf with the rapier stuck in its back. Giving the wolf barely any time to counter, Neik jumped, kicked the wolf in the side of the head, and swung his sword down onto its back. The wolf having been in motion as he did so threw his trajectory off a tad, thus resulting in him losing the desired power that was intended. His sword now stuck halfway through the beast's back, it was clear that it was a goner; more than half of its flesh was nearly cleaved in two, and it was bleeding profusely. Not letting go of his weapon in the way Clementine had done before him, he switched his hold on it, now propelling himself in midair as the wolf ran to the side of the pack. 2 other wolves were closing in on his rear, so he chose to act fast. Flipping up above the wolf, he planted his boot directly down onto the bottom of the hilt of Clementine's blade, jamming the rapier into its intended target: the monster's heart.

In a loud thump of fur and flesh, the giant wolf fell to the ground, dead. Wasting no more time, Neik spun around to the wolf's other side, using the leverage and momentum to free his blade, whilst clutching hold of Clementine's rapier with his free hand, pulling it from the beast lying dead at his feet with a spin to face the 2 wolves closing in. Now slightly covered in the blood of the monster, Neik prepared for the second assault, almost forgetting that he was not alone as he usually was. Bringing the blade up that reminded him of that, he tossed it, hilt up, to its rightful owner, who caught it with a fumbling display of her regular clumsiness.

"NEVER lose your weapon in battle...!" he spat out at the girl behind him, not taking his eyes off the wolves who chose to stop halfway through their assault, which now went back to snarling threats once more. He was angry at her amateur display of fighting, and had a few more choice words for her, but they would have to come later, after they were finished with this lot...
